The Simley High School Bands hosted and participated in the Minnesota State High School League Region 3AA Instrumental Large Group Contest on March 6th. Five schools and nine bands performed musical selections for a three judge panel. The Simley High School Wind Ensemble and Symphonic Band each received the highest overall score of "SUPERIOR." Each judge scores the musical selections on tone quality, intonation, rhythm, balance and blend, technique, articulation and other performance factors, such as the choice of literature, appearance and conduct.
